Community Goal: Thargoids Return

On the 16th October 2020 Frontier announced the return of the Thargoids via a new community goal.


“Thargoid vessels detected in Alliance-controlled systems within the Witch Head Enclave. The Thargoids have reappeared in the Witch Head Nebula, and are swarming in large numbers through the Onoros, Lembass, Haki, Wellington and Shenve systems. Sixteen systems within the nebula were colonised last year to form the Witch Head Enclave, after a successful initiative to locate fresh barnacle sites. This initially triggered a hostile reaction from the Thargoids, but their presence was relatively low until now. Captain Warren Lamar, head of security for the Alliance Expeditionary Pact, put out an urgent call for assistance:

“If this Thargoid assault is not repelled, it may spread into a full-scale invasion throughout the Witch Head Enclave. Neither Aegis nor the Alliance Defence Force are able to deploy in time, so we ask all independent combat pilots and anti-xeno squadrons to come to our defence.”

The Alliance Expeditionary Pact has confirmed that it will offer generous rewards to all Commanders who assist with destroying Thargoid vessels. The top 75% of contributors will have Guardian Frame Shift Drive Boosters unlocked and a size four module put into storage for them at the Golden Stag by the 24th of October.”

Update: Mission Rewards tweak

On the 14th October Frontier posted on the official forum that missions rewards had received a re-balancing.

“Many mission rewards have been increased, while passenger mission rewards are slightly decreased to create a better overall balance across the board. This balance is part of an on-going process and we will continue to make changes as required.

“Additionally, we’ve fixed an issue whereby passenger missions will now award points toward the correct Elite rank.”
